Abstract
The increase of the volume of containerized goods in the worldwide trade imposes the need for the analysis and improvement of all aspects of container transport logistic chains, and therefore also the organization of inland intermodal terminals and the mechanization for reloading of containers from ships (barges), trains and trucks. This paper analyzes the crane scheduling for the reloading of containers from / to trains at inland intermodal terminals. In order to find the exact solution for container reloading from / to a train, a branch and bound method was developed.
